#8 Post by Terrahawk » Thu Aug 18, 2016 7:34 am

For anyone who's still interested in this year and a half old thread, I have succeeded restoring one of our Thinkpad Tablet 2s using a USB recovery image created by... our other Thinkpad Tablet 2 using the built in Windows recovery media creator. The biggest hassle was getting it to boot for the USB stick. We did have a working Windows install, so we just rebooted into recovery mode (under settings in Windows) and instructed the Windows boot loader to boot from the stick. Alternatively you can go into the bios (power up while holding the volume up button, then release when you see the Lenovo logo, the bios is text but responds to touch) and set the tablet to boot to USB first.

Only thing is though, the recovery image is the original Windows 8.0 one that shipped with the tablet, so I then had to install a heap of updates, then update it to 8.1 afterward.
